Robert D. Fiore 1935-2007 SPRINGFIELD - Robert D. "Bob" Fiore, 72, a longtime resident of East Longmeadow, passed away on Thursday, March 15, 2007, at Baystate Medical Center. He was born in Springfield on March 7, 1935, a son of the late Robert A. and Antoinette ( Buoniconti) Fiore. Bob was...
